Ingredients make Spicy Mexican Enchilada sauce.

  1. It's 2 can 800g tomatoes, peeled and chopped.
  2. It's 3 medium onions, chopped.
  3. It's 1 large green bell pepper, chopped.
  4. It's 4 clove garlic, minced.
  5. You need 6 tsp oregano dried.
  6. It's 3 tsp chili powder.
  7. You need 3 tsp cocoa powder.
  8. Prepare 2 tsp salt.
  9. You need 1 tsp ground black pepper.
  10. Prepare 2 tbsp sugar.
  11. Prepare 250 ml tomato catchup.
  12. It's 100 ml water.
  13. You need 30 ml olive oil.

Spicy Mexican Enchilada sauce. instructions

  1. Braise onions and green pepper in olive oil until lightly brown.
  2. Cook tomato over medium heat for 30 minutes, stirring constantly.
  3. Add onions and green peppers to tomatoes and simmer for a further 20 minutes, stirring constantly.
  4. Now add the remainder of the ingredients and continue simmering over a low heat for 30 minutes, stirring constantly.
  5. Let the sauce cool enough to be able to be liquidised in a food processor. Liquidise until smooth..
